Fig. 2: Effects of changes in image preprocessing on AI-based racial identity prediction.

From: Acquisition parameters influence AI recognition of race in chest x-rays and mitigating these factors reduces underdiagnosis bias

Fig. 2

The average scores of the racial identity prediction model were computed for different window width and field of view values and compared to the default preprocessing used to train the model. The average scores were computed in a weighted fashion to equally weight each patient race across the test dataset (see “Methods”). The percent change in average score per race is plotted. A positive change (red) indicates an increase in the average score for the corresponding race and preprocessing combination across the entire test set. Results are shown separately for the CXP and MXR datasets. Source data are provided as a Source data file.
